Doug Stanhope is a degenerate and this is his story; which is also the story of his unorthodox relationship with his mother. It reads like an honest, no holds barred, more or less true account. At least, I hope it is because I shudder to imagine what kind of content he may have omitted or toned down otherwise.Although I am a fan of the comedian, I didn't have high expectations of the writer. Well, I was surprised. It's very readable, the narrative flows and the man can put a sentence together. It is shocking, offensive, outrageous, achingly sad and very, very funny. (I note a few reviewers somewhere complained that the book was too long in the middle; these people should read shorter books).On completion, I have two questions: why is Doug Stanhope still alive and how has he managed to avoid incarceration?A note on the copy and who I would recommend it to: Kindle copy - good with occasional formatting errors; I also couldn't read some of the note and letter copies included but that might just be my eyesight. For fans, voyeurs in general and the morally bankrupt.

Stanhope's comedy is frequently pretty challenging, with jokes about abortion, babies, transvestite hookers, sex toys, drugs and a whole bunch of stuff someone will take umbrage at - but as an audience you're always aware that the tale has been ramped up for comedic effect and the truth may have been buffed to a shine for your enjoyment. This book in contrast is just straight out honest in its approach, covering Doug's childhood up to the present day and including the important stuff, not just the funny stuff - the marriages on a whim, the arguments, the mental state of Mother and her hoarding, her own acting career, his "hey there guy" father, his Marine brother and their childhood goofs, the whole shebang.As such, it doesn't read like a Stanhope stand-up routine - but it's very very good, completely engaging, written in a way that's easy to read but with such detail and nuance that you don't want to skim read it. It starts with Mother's death and then goes back to the start and works through chronologically and doesn't pre-introduce anyone - Bingo for example isn't even mentioned (intro excepting) until Doug meets her in the progress of the story. It unfolds as it progresses.Essentially - if you're a Stanhope fan, if you've been listening for years, you follow the podcasts, all that - you know bits of his history. This is all of it, but the important bits, not just the funny ones. It's well worth the purchase price, order it now.
